PDA

Archiv verlassen und diese Seite im Standarddesign anzeigen : Autostart einer diskette



Malice
05.02.2001, 20:02
ist es möglich, das selbe wie bei einer CD mit der autostart, mit einer Disc zu verantworten?

malice.

rot
06.02.2001, 13:07
Also, ich glaub da geht es nicht um Verantwortung, sondern darum, dass das einfach nicht möglich ist, weil eine Diskette nicht dafür geeignet ist, oder warum auch immer.

Auf jeden Fall gehts nicht!

mfg

juggler
06.02.2001, 18:43
Soweit ich weiß geht es nur auf HD bzw. CD's. Das Betriebssystem prüft in den darauf vorhandenen Laufwerken in gewissen Zeitabständen auf die Existenz der Datei autorun.inf im jeweiligen root Verzeichnis. Falls vorhandenen wird das darin definierte Programm aufgerufen. Ansonsten tut sich nichts. Bei meinem PC habe ich es untersagt, da ich immer irgendwelche CD's in den Laufwerken drinn lasse und keine Lust habe, daß diese immer automatisch gestartet werden.

juggler

Moskito
06.02.2001, 19:02
Nein, das geht nicht!
Denn bei CDs wird jeder Wechsel vom Betriebssystem registriert, und wenn die Datei autorun.inf vorhanden ist, die darin eingetragene Programme gestartet. Nach dem neustart des Windows (als Beispiel) wird beim ersten anzeigen der Laufwerke (wo auch immer) zuerst alle automatischen Laufwerke auf das enthalten von Datenträgern geprüft. Das heisst, der PC sucht nach eingelegten Cds. Die Diskettenlaufwerke werden aber nicht geprüft.
Die Disketten legst du manuell ein, das heisst, der Computer hat keine Informationen, ob jetzt gerade eine Diskette eingelegt ist, bzw eingelegt wurde. Deshalb prüft das System immer vor dem öffnen des Laufwerkes a: bzw b: ob überhaupt eine Diskette eingelegt ist. Eine CD wird automatisch eingezogen, und der PC "merkt" das. Dann wird die Autorunfunktion ausgeführt.

Gruss MOSKITO

Malice
06.02.2001, 19:48
das mit dem cd-lauwerk weiß ich.

es ist doch so:
um den inhalt einer diskette anzeigen zu lassen, muss sie gelsen und ausgewertet werden. (sei es im win-expl.; arbeitsplatz; suche etc.)
ich frage mich, lässt sich dieser umstand nicht ausnutzen (der umstand, dass die disc gelsen wird). ich dachte, möglicherweise wird dabei auch auf die inf geprüft und gestartet. naja, muss ich halt manuell starten. nevermind. :)

danke trotzdem.

malice.

Frechdachs
03.03.2001, 17:22
Ich weiß nicht ob du das hier suchst, aber ich poste es einfach mal:

Wenn du dein Diskettenlaufwerk für den Autostart freigeben willst, mußt du in der Registry (Start, Ausführen, regedit) den Wert "NoDriveTypeAutoRun" in
HKEY_CURRENT_USER\ Software\ Microsoft\ Windows\ CurrentVersion\ Policies\ Explorer
ändern.
Der Wert müßte auf "95 00 00 00" gesetzt sein und du müßtest ihn in "91 00 00 00" setzen.

Jetzt kannst du nach einem Neustart die Autorun-Funktion von Diskette testen, bevor du CD's brennst.
Der PC erkennt natürlich nicht automatisch, daß die Diskette gewechselt wurde, aber wenn du auf Arbeitsplatz; Diskettenlaufwerk doppelklickst, startet der Autorun, wenn auf der Diskette eine autorun.inf mit Inhalt existiert!